Detailed Information

This professional blade for vacuum packaging (MAP — Modified Atmosphere Packaging) machines is precision CNC-machined from Sheffield steel. HRC 58-60 Rockwell hardness is achieved through heat treatment in controlled atmosphere furnaces.

Delivers surface quality compliant with HACCP and BRC standards for the food industry. Ra ≤0.4 µm surface roughness prevents food particles from adhering to the blade surface, maintaining hygiene standards.

Compatible Machine Brands: Multivac, Tiromat, Opack, Betapak, GEA CFS, Alcan, Ulma Packaging, Variovac, Sealpac, Webomatic, Henkelman.

This is the general reference product for all thermoform vacuum packaging blade types including straight cut, contour cut, star punch, and air punch. Our technical support team ensures the optimal SKU match for your specific machine model.
